Accord Mortgages, a subsidiary of Yorkshire Building Society, has been operating in the UK mortgage market since 2007. The lender offers a variety of mortgage products, including fixed and variable rate mortgages, buy-to-let mortgages, and remortgage options. Accord Mortgages has also won multiple industry awards for its innovative products and excellent customer service. However, the lender is not immune to customer complaints.
One of the most common criticisms levelled against Accord Mortgages is its customer service. Several customers have reported experiencing long wait times on the phone when trying to contact the lender. Some customers have also complained of unclear and confusing information provided by the lender’s customer service representatives. This has caused frustration and inconvenience for many borrowers, who have had to spend hours trying to get through to the lender and resolve their issues.
Another area where Accord Mortgages has faced criticism is with regards to its lending criteria. Some borrowers have reported that their applications were rejected by the lender without a clear explanation, despite meeting all the eligibility criteria. Some customers have also complained of the lender’s rigid approach to assessing affordability, which has prevented them from securing a mortgage.
Accord Mortgages has also been criticised for delays in processing applications. Some borrowers have reported waiting for weeks, or even months, to get a response from the lender on their mortgage application. This has caused them unnecessary stress and uncertainty, especially if they are relying on the mortgage for a property purchase or remortgage.
However, it’s important to note that not all customers have had negative experiences with Accord Mortgages. Many borrowers have praised the lender for its competitive rates and flexible mortgage options. Some customers have also commended the lender’s online account management platform, which allows them to manage their mortgage accounts and make payments conveniently.
